Abstract

The present invention relates to a device and a method for confirming whether or not an e-mail is received without a periodic polling process in a portable terminal, and confirms that a new mail exists in a mail server and downloads the new mail from the mail server. And a mail agent for transmitting a message informing of the existence of new mail to a pre-registered mail client, and for transmitting the mail to the mail client when receiving a message requesting a received mail from the mail client. In the case of receiving a message indicating the existence of new mail, a periodic polling process performed when the mail is received in the existing mobile communication system, including the mail client transmitting the message requesting the received mail to the mail agent. Omit the existing push when Solve the cost problem arising from the use of the system and also can simultaneously determine the presence or absence of the incoming mail mail server.

The present invention relates to a mobile communication system, and more particularly, to a device and a method for confirming whether or not an e-mail is received without a periodic polling process in a portable terminal.

In recent years, portable terminals have been used indispensably for modern people regardless of whether they are male or female, and service providers and terminal manufacturers are developing products (or services) competitively in order to differentiate them from other companies.

For example, the portable terminal may include a phone book, a game, a short message, an e-mail, a morning call, an MP 3 layer, and a schedule management function. It has developed into a multimedia device capable of digital cameras and wireless Internet services to provide various services.

In particular, the e-mail service is one of many services used by many users by allowing the portable terminal to directly check the document confirmation that can be confirmed after connecting to the Internet using a computer supporting a protocol such as SMTP / POP3 / IMAP4.

However, in order to use the above-mentioned e-mail service, the user accesses the e-mail server providing the e-mail service using personal information (for example, e-mail account ID and password), and then polls to check whether the e-mail is received. There is a problem that the process must be performed.

That is, the user of the portable terminal cannot determine whether a new mail has been received before performing the above polling operation.

The above problem is solved by using a push system for transmitting an e-mail received to the mail server to a portable terminal. However, there is a problem that maintenance is difficult due to the interworking of the mail server and the push system.

Accordingly, there is a need for an apparatus and method for confirming whether a new mail received from a portable terminal as described above is received by a mail server.

In the following description, a description will be given of an apparatus and method for allowing a portable terminal to check whether a mail server receives new mail.

The mail agent defined in the following description is a device that performs a polling process by connecting to a mail server, and can communicate with a portable terminal. The portable agent is driven by the personal computer and the personal computer on which an application such as Outlook is installed. It is meant to include the application to enable communication with.

1 is a diagram illustrating a mobile communication system for providing a push email service according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ention.

Referring to FIG. 1, the mobile communication system may include a mail agent 100, a mail client 110, and a mail server 120.

First, the mail agent 100 may be configured to include a control unit 102, a mail confirmation unit 104 and a communication unit 106, the control unit 102 causes the mail confirmation unit 104 at a predetermined time period It is connected to the mail server 120 and instructs to confirm whether a new mail has been received.

That is, the mail agent may run on a personal computer in which an application such as Outlook is installed and check whether new mail is received at the mail server using the application.

If it is confirmed that the new mail is received by the mail checking unit 104, the control unit 102 transmits a message notifying the reception of the mail to the pre-registered mail client 110 through the communication unit 106. Do it.

In addition, when receiving the control message from the mail client 110, the control unit 102 processes to perform the operation according to the message.

For example, when receiving a message requesting to download the mail received from the mail client 110, the control unit 102 is connected to the mail server 120 to download the received mail The downloaded mail is transferred to the mail client 110.

When receiving a message for controlling the mail agent 100 from the mail client 110, the controller 102 powers off the mail agent according to the received message. Process to turn on.

The mail checker 104 receives the mail by receiving a command from the controller 102 and performing a periodic polling process by connecting to the mail server 120 using a program such as Outlook. Check for presence.

The mail client 110 refers to a portable terminal, and may include a control unit 114 and a communication unit 112.

When the control unit 114 of the mail client 110 receives a message informing of reception of a new mail from the mail agent 100, the control unit 114 outputs a control menu and detects a menu selection by a user.

If the mail client 110 detects the selection of a menu requesting the received mail, after generating a message informing of the mail request, the mail client 110 generates the message through the communication unit 112. To send).

Thereafter, the control unit 114 of the mail client 110 decompresses the mail received from the mail agent 100 and then provides the received mail to the user of the portable terminal.

On the other hand, if the control unit 114 of the mail client 110 detects the selection of the menu to control the mail agent 100, generates a message to control the daily agent to the mail agent 100 Process to send.

2 is a flowchart illustrating a process of providing a push email from a mail agent to a portable terminal according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ention. In the following description, the portable terminal means a mail client.

Referring to FIG. 2, the mail agent 100 first checks the mail server 120 in step 201 to check whether a new mail has been received. The mail agent 100 may determine whether the mail is received by using an application such as Outlook installed on a personal computer, and the application periodically registers account information and periodically polls. Through the mail server 120 may determine whether a new mail is received.

If it is not confirmed that the mail is received, the mail agent 100 proceeds to step 209 to perform a corresponding function (eg, standby mode).

On the other hand, when confirming the mail reception, the mail agent 100 proceeds to step 203 and transmits a message indicating a new mail arrival to the portable terminal 110, a mail client, proceeds to step 205 and proceeds to the portable terminal ( Receive a control message from 110.

Here, the control message is a message that allows the portable terminal 110 to control the mail agent 100 to download a new mail, and to control the power of the computer containing the mail agent 100 It may contain a message.

In step 207, the mail agent 100 reads the message received from the portable terminal 110 and performs an operation corresponding to the control command of the message.

Herein, an operation corresponding to the control command will be described in detail with reference to FIG. 3.

Thereafter, the mail agent 100 ends the present algorithm.

3 is a flowchart illustrating a process of performing an operation according to a control command of a portable terminal in a mail agent according to an embodiment of the present invention. In the following description, the portable terminal means a mail client.

Referring to FIG. 3, the mail agent 100 first proceeds to step 301 and checks whether the message read in step 207 of FIG. 2 is a message including a control command to download a newly received mail.

If the message is requested to download the mail, the mail agent 100 proceeds to step 303 to download the received mails in connection with the mail server 120 and proceeds to step 305 to download the mail. Process to compress the loaded mails.

Here, the process of compressing the mails is a process performed to increase the transmission efficiency of the received mail, and compresses the mail in text format into a binary form suitable for a wireless environment.

In step 307, the mail agent 100 transmits the compressed mail to the mobile terminal 110.

On the other hand, when it is confirmed in step 301 that the received message is not a message for requesting to download the mail, the mail agent 100 proceeds to step 309 and includes the device including the mail agent 100. (E.g., a personal computer) to see if the message contains a command to control it.

If the message to control the device is received in step 309, the mail agent 100 proceeds to step 311 and performs a control operation (eg, PC power on, off, etc.) corresponding to the command. .

Thereafter, the mail agent 100 ends the present algorithm.

4 is a flowchart illustrating a process of controlling a mail agent in a portable terminal according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ention. In the following description, the portable terminal means a mail client.

Referring to FIG. 4, the portable terminal 110 first checks whether a message indicating the arrival of a new mail is received from the mail agent 100 in step 401. If the message is not received, the portable terminal 110 proceeds to step 415 to perform a corresponding function (eg, standby mode).

On the other hand, when confirming that the message is received, the portable terminal 110 proceeds to step 403 and outputs a control menu. Here, the control menu may include a menu for downloading a mail received through the mail agent 100 and a menu for controlling a device including the mail agent 100.

Thereafter, the portable terminal 110 proceeds to step 405 to check whether the user selects a menu selection by the user of the portable terminal 110.

If the user does not detect the menu selection, the portable terminal 110 performs the process of step 403 again.

On the other hand, when detecting the user's menu selection, the portable terminal 110 proceeds to step 407 to check whether the menu detected in step 405 is a mail request menu.

If the mobile terminal 110 detects the selection of the mail request menu, the mobile terminal 110 proceeds to step 409 to generate a mail request message and transmits the mail request message to the mail agent 100. Receive a mail sent from 100.

Here, the received mail is compressed in order to increase the efficiency of mail transmission.

In step 413, the portable terminal 110 outputs the received mail. Here, the portable terminal 110 may decompress the received mail and then process the output of the mail.

On the other hand, if the check result of step 407 does not detect the selection of the mail request menu (if it detects a menu selection to control a personal computer including a mail agent), the process proceeds to step 417 to control the personal computer. A message is generated and transmitted to the mail agent 100.

Thereafter, the portable terminal 110 ends the present algorithm.

4 is a method of controlling the mail agent 100 after performing a process of detecting a mail agent control menu selection by a user in the portable terminal 110 according to an embodiment of the present invention (manual mail reception). Method), the present invention may control the mail agent 100 (automatic mail receiving method) without detecting the menu selection.

That is, when the mail agent 100 confirms receipt of the new mail from the mail server 120, the mail agent 100 transmits a message informing the reception of the new mail to the portable terminal 110 and receives the message. May transmit a message requesting the received mail to the mail agent 100.

In addition, the portable terminal 110 transmits the message requesting the received mail, and if the response message for the message is not received from the mail agent 100 for a predetermined time, the mail agent 100 It may be determined that the device (eg, the personal computer) of the including device is powered off, and a message for controlling the device may be generated and transmitted to the mail agent 100.

5 is a diagram illustrating a configuration of a message used in a mobile communication system according to an embodiment of the present invention.

FIG. 5 (a) is a diagram illustrating a format of a message informing the reception of a new message from the mail agent 100 to the portable terminal 110, which is a mail client.

Referring to FIG. 5A, the message is a field 503 including a unique information field 501 which the mail agent 100 grants to the portable terminal 110 and information indicating new mail reception. Can be configured.

Here, the unique information 501 means information for identifying the portable terminal 110 requesting the received mail.

5 (b) is a diagram illustrating a message transmitted from the portable terminal 110 to the mail agent 100.

Referring to FIG. 5B, the message includes a field 505 indicating unique information provided by the mail agent 100 and a field 507 including a control command for controlling the mail agent 100. It can be configured as.

The control command 507 may include a mail request command 509 for downloading a new mail and a PC control command 511 for controlling the power of the mail agent 100.

FIG. 5C is a diagram illustrating a message used when the mail agent 100 wants to transmit an email received from the portable terminal 110.

Referring to FIG. 5C, the message includes a field 513 indicating unique information of the mobile terminal 110 that has performed a mail request and a field including a received mail to be transmitted to the mobile terminal 110 ( 515).

As described above, in the mobile communication system according to the present invention, when it is confirmed that a new mail is received at the mail server through an application (eg, Outlook) that can be connected to the mail server, the mobile terminal transmits a message notifying the reception of the mail to the portable terminal. By using the mail agent, it is possible to omit the periodic polling process performed when checking the mail reception in the existing mobile communication system.

In addition, according to the present invention can solve the cost problem caused by the use of the existing push system and at the same time can check whether the mail server receives the mail.
